The tenth word of verse (12:110) is divided into 2 morphological segments. A noun and possessive pronoun. The noun is masculine and is in the nominative case (مرفوع). The noun's triliteral root is nūn ṣād rā (ن ص ر). The attached possessive pronoun is first person plural.
